GeForce GT 640M vs Radeon RX Vega 6 Ryzen 3 3200U Technical Specifications

Side-by-side specs, architecture details, clocks, memory, power, and platform differences.

NVIDIA

GeForce GT 640M

The GeForce GT 640M is manufactured by NVIDIA. It was released in March 22 2012. It features the Kepler architecture. The core clock ranges from Up to 625 MHz to 645 MHz. It has 384 shading units. The thermal design power (TDP) is 32W. Manufactured using 28 nm process technology. G3D Mark benchmark score: 907 points.

AMD

Radeon RX Vega 6 Ryzen 3 3200U

The Radeon RX Vega 6 Ryzen 3 3200U is manufactured by AMD. It was released in January 7 2018. It features the Vega architecture. The core clock ranges from 300 MHz to 1100 MHz. It has 384 shading units. The thermal design power (TDP) is 15W. Manufactured using 14 nm process technology. G3D Mark benchmark score: 906 points.

Graphics Performance

The GeForce GT 640M scores 907 and the Radeon RX Vega 6 Ryzen 3 3200U reaches 906 in the G3D Mark benchmark — just a 0.1% difference, making them near-identical in rasterization performance. The GeForce GT 640M is built on Kepler while the Radeon RX Vega 6 Ryzen 3 3200U uses Vega, both on 28 nm vs 14 nm. Shader units: 384 (GeForce GT 640M) vs 384 (Radeon RX Vega 6 Ryzen 3 3200U). Raw compute: 0.48 TFLOPS (GeForce GT 640M) vs 1.306 TFLOPS (Radeon RX Vega 6 Ryzen 3 3200U). Boost clocks: 645 MHz vs 1100 MHz.
